Very nice results for a 24-year-old stock Cobra engine with 80K miles, although not really that surprising. Let's not forget that the GT/LX motors were rated at 225hp at 4200rpm and 300 ft-lb at 3200rpm from '87 thru '92 before Ford mysteriously lowered these numbers to 205hp at 4200rpm and 275 ft-...

Re: plugs for supercharger?

Hey there, On my 13ish PSI 570whp (mustang dyno) '89 coupe I ran Autolite 3923. I had an MSD ignition and coil and never had reason to believe that I had the spark blow out problem. Lot of guys gap them real tight to prevent that. If your ignition is stock you may need to. I think I was gapped at 50...
